  • What are prebiotics and probiotics? Prebiotics are food components that microbes break down and use as energy while providing beneficial compounds like short-chain fatty acids for our bodies to use. Probiotics are live microorganisms that have been shown to be beneficial to health. They’re found in foods like fermented dairy products as well as dietary supplements.       If you liked this video, you may also want to know that there are advantages and disadvantages to taking soil-based probiotics. For example, soil-based probiotics are more spore-forming. The spore creates a protective barrier so that the microorganisms are more likely to travel through the stomach without being destroyed by stomach acid. So they are more likely to attach in the gut, and be effective. On the other hand, this can be a negative if the microorganism causes an infection, because it is then more resistant to an antibiotic that may be needed to treat the infection!
